Programming/Socket
PF_INET과 AF_INET
whitele
2021. 3. 3. 15:31
반응형
socket 함수를 사용하면서 도메인을 지정할 때 사용하는 PF_INET , 가끔 AF_INET이 보일때도 있다. 사실 선언된 내용은 동일한 내용이므로 어떤 상수를 사용해도 상관이 없다.
PF_INET
Protocol Family의 약자
AF_INET
Address Family의 약자이다.
PF_INET | IPV4 인터넷 프로토콜 패키지 |
PF_INET6 | IPV6 인터넷 프로토콜 패키지 |
PF_LOCAL | 로컬 유닉스계열 소켓 프로그램 패밀리 |
PF_UNIX | 로컬 유닉스계열 소켓 프로그램 패밀리 |
어떤 것을 사용해도 상관은 없지만,
소켓 프로토콜 생성에는 PF_INET를, 주소 구조체 생성에는 AF_INET을 사용하는 것이 암묵적인 룰이다.
728x90
반응형